SUBJECT: GRB 161117A: Swift/UVOT Detection
DATE: 16/11/17 23:04:40 GMT
FROM: Frank Marshall at GSFC <femarsha at khamseen.gsfc.nasa.gov>
F. E. Marshall (NASA/GSFC) and J. R. Cummings (NASA/UMBC)
report on behalf of the Swift/UVOT team:
The Swift/UVOT began settled observations of the field of GRB 161117A
69 s after the BAT trigger (Cummings et al., GCN Circ. 20179).
A source consistent with the XRT position
(Goad et al., GCN Circ. 20184)
is detected in the initial UVOT exposures.
The preliminary UVOT position is:
RA (J2000) = 21:28:12.55 = 322.05230 (deg.)
Dec (J2000) = -29:36:49.1 = -29.61365 (deg.)
with an estimated uncertainty of 0.44 arc sec. (radius, 90% confidence).
Preliminary detections and 3-sigma upper limits using the UVOT photometric system
(Breeveld et al. 2011, AIP Conf. Proc. 1358, 373) for the early exposures are
in the table below. The lack of detections in the m2 and w2 filters
is consistent with the redshift of 1.549 reported by
Malesani et al. (GCN Circ. 20180).
Filter T_start(s) T_stop(s) Exp(s) Mag
white 69 219 147 18.26 +/- 0.05
v 611 6146 255 18.77 +/- 0.19
b 536 5531 236 19.42 +/- 0.17
u 281 531 246 19.48 +/- 0.20
w1 660 6556 255 19.48 +/- 0.25
m2 1064 13173 712 >20.2
w2 586 11751 1141 >20.8
The magnitudes in the table are not corrected for the Galactic extinction
due to the reddening of E(B-V) = 0.06 in the direction of the burst
(Schlegel et al. 1998).
